Ping. On Sat, Jun 11, 2011 at 8:58 AM, H.J. Lu <hongjiu...@intel.com> wrote: > Hi, > > convert_memory_address_addr_space has a special PLUS/MULT case for > POINTERS_EXTEND_UNSIGNED < 0. It turns out that it is also needed > for all Pmode != ptr_mode cases. OK for trunk? > > Thanks. > > > H.J. > --- > 2011-06-11 H.J. Lu <hongjiu...@intel.com> > > PR middle-end/47727 > * explow.c (convert_memory_address_addr_space): Permute the > conversion and addition if one operand is a constant. > > diff --git a/gcc/explow.c b/gcc/explow.c > index 7387dad..b343bf8 100644 > --- a/gcc/explow.c > +++ b/gcc/explow.c > @@ -383,18 +383,13 @@ convert_memory_address_addr_space (enum machine_mode > to_mode ATTRIBUTE_UNUSED, > > case PLUS: > case MULT: > - /* For addition we can safely permute the conversion and addition > - operation if one operand is a constant and converting the constant > - does not change it or if one operand is a constant and we are > - using a ptr_extend instruction (POINTERS_EXTEND_UNSIGNED < 0). > - We can always safely permute them if we are making the address > - narrower. */ > + /* For addition we safely permute the conversion and addition > + operation if one operand is a constant since we can't generate > + new instructions. We can always safely permute them if we are > + making the address narrower. */ > if (GET_MODE_SIZE (to_mode) < GET_MODE_SIZE (from_mode) > || (GET_CODE (x) == PLUS > - && CONST_INT_P (XEXP (x, 1)) > - && (XEXP (x, 1) == convert_memory_address_addr_space > - (to_mode, XEXP (x, 1), as) > - || POINTERS_EXTEND_UNSIGNED < 0))) > + && CONST_INT_P (XEXP (x, 1)))) > return gen_rtx_fmt_ee (GET_CODE (x), to_mode, > convert_memory_address_addr_space > (to_mode, XEXP (x, 0), as), >
